Nightlife Tips

  • Opening Hours: Rome's nightlife kicks off at sunset and lasts into the early morning, with clubs often open until 4:00 a.m.
  • Nightlife Districts: Trastevere, Testaccio, and Monti are the main nightlife areas, offering a mix of bars, clubs, and rooftop lounges.
  • Prices: Standard European prices apply, with aperitivo around €10 and drinks at upscale venues costing €15–€20.

Wine in Rome: Italy is known for its incredible wines, and Roman enoteche (wine bars) are popular social spots. Local varieties like Frascati and Montepulciano are widely enjoyed, making wine a staple in Roman nightlife. While beer is less of a tradition, craft beer bars have been growing in popularity across the city.

Nightlife in Rome

Via della Pace, near Piazza Navona, is Rome’s most popular nightlife street, buzzing with bars, cafes, and clubs. For a vibrant experience, explore the lively areas between Campo de' Fiori and Trastevere, known for its bars, pubs, and clubs.

A must-visit is Freni e Frizioni in Trastevere, famous for its unique cocktails and lively atmosphere. The area offers a mix of traditional wine bars and modern clubs, combining historic charm with contemporary nightlife.

For an upscale evening, visit restaurants like Pierluigi and Ristorante Aroma along the Tiber, offering Italian cuisine and stunning views of landmarks like the Colosseum. Rome’s nightlife truly has something for everyone.

Trastevere: The Heartbeat of Rome’s Nightlife

Trastevere is a popular nightlife destination for both Romans and tourists. Imagine an area of cobblestone alleyways dotted with cosy wine bars, vibrant taverns, and thriving eateries. As the sun sets, the neighbourhood comes alive with laughing, music, and clinking glasses.

Begin your evening with a traditional aperitivo at Freni e Frizioni, where locals mingle over spritz and olives. From there, discover the area's hidden gems—each lane appears to disclose a new location to sip an Italian wine or a speciality drink

Trastevere's bohemian vibe and picturesque piazzas make it ideal for everyone who want a peaceful but bustling setting. Trastevere provides a genuine Roman atmosphere, whether you're dancing in a tiny bar or conversing with friends in a lovely plaza.

Campo de’ Fiori: From Market to Midnight Madness

By day, Campo de' Fiori is a bustling market, filled with delicious fruit and fresh flowers. But once night falls, it changes into one of Rome's most popular nightlife destinations.

As people assemble around Giordano Bruno's iconic monument, the plaza transforms into the centre of a vibrant social scene. The bars and pubs that surround the plaza are packed with people enjoying drinks, handmade beers, and good conversation.

Start with The Drunken Ship, a popular hangout for students and visitors, and then go on to other pubs such as Magnolia or La Vineria. The ambiance is lively and enjoyable, making it an ideal venue to make new friends and experience Rome's dynamic nightlife. If you are hungry, the nearby streets are lined with late-night cafés that serve wonderful pizzas and pasta until the early hours.

Monti: Where the Cool Kids Hang Out

Monti, located between the Colosseum and Via Nazionale, attracts Rome's trendsetting population. Its small lanes are lined with eccentric bars, trendy cafés, and chic shops, giving it a distinct, bohemian vibe.

Begin your evening at Black Market Hall, a cosy pub with antique décor and live music that draws a creative crowd. From there, walk through the labyrinthine alleyways, where cosy wine bars and cool nightclubs await behind unmarked doors. Monti's nightlife is more relaxed but nevertheless lively, making it suited for people who prefer handmade drinks and discussion over a chaotic party atmosphere.

If you're looking for something sweet, Fatamorgana serves some of Rome's finest handmade gelato. Monti, with its laid-back ambiance and varied audience, provides a different perspective on Roman nightlife.

Attend an Opera Performance

Imagine sitting in the grand Teatro dell'Opera di Roma, where the curtains lift and the stage comes alive with captivating music and dramatic performances. Attending an opera in Rome is not just a night out; it's a deep dive into Italian culture and history. Whether you're drawn to Verdi or Puccini, the powerful vocals and stunning settings will mesmerize you.

For a more intimate experience, many churches in Rome host evening concerts featuring classical music. The exceptional acoustics and serene atmosphere create a truly enchanting experience.

Even if you don't understand the language, the performers' emotions and passion will resonate with you. Dress up, take your seat, and let the music carry you on an unforgettable journey through Italian opera.
